FlowCV Logo
Uday Kumar
Email
[email protected]
Phone
07483019823
Location
G08 Kumari Lotus Junnasandra Main Road
LinkedIn
www.linkedin.com/in/ uday-kumar-43ba71257
Profile

Highly skilled and experienced SDET with 15 years of expertise in software testing, test automation, and manual testing in the broadcasting domain. Seeking a challenging position to utilise my technical skills and domain knowledge to ensure the delivery of high-quality software solutions.

Skills
programing Language — java, python, Automated Testing Tools — Selenium WebDriver, TestNG, Testing Methodologies — Knowledge of manual testing, API testing, performance testing, regression testing, and test planning, CI & CD — Jenkins, Defect/Test Management — JIRA, CDETS, ALM, Bugzilla, Test Track pro., Software Testing Life Cycle (STLC) and (SDLC), Strong Problem-Solving and Debugging Skills, Excellent Communication and Collaboration Skills, Operating Systems — Windows, Linux
Professional Summary
  • Proficient in test automation using Selenium WebDriver, creating test scripts, and executing test cases.
  • Strong knowledge of STB (Set-Top Box) Integration, including testing and validating the integration of software components.
  • Experience in Embedded Linux security by performing Linux Hardening compliance.
  • Familiarity with Agile methodologies and continuous integration/continuous delivery (CI/CD) pipelines.
  • Excellent problem-solving and debugging skills to identify and resolve software defects.
  • Strong understanding of software development life cycle (SDLC) and software testing principles.
  • Ability to work collaboratively in cross-functional teams and communicate effectively with developers, testers, and stakeholders.
  • Proficient in programming languages such as Java, Python.
  • Experience with version control systems (e.g., Git) and defect tracking tools (e.g., JIRA).
  • Work Experience
    Lead Software Engineer, Synamedia India Private Ltd
    03/2019 – present | Bangalore, India
  • Responsible for leading end to end development of new EPG (Java) feature on STB from requirement finalisation to deployment by holding scrum meetings, conducting code reviews, and increasing unit test coverage.
  • Designed and implemented an end-to-end test automation framework in Java, using Selenium WebDriver, which reduced regression test execution time by 50%.
  • Collaborated with development and product teams to define test strategies, test plans, and test cases.
  • Helped the team to ensured that user stories were sized and delivered in a timely manner by conducting code reviews, providing technical guidance and ensuring adherence to best practices.
  • Integrated test automation into the CI/CD pipeline using Jenkins, enabling continuous testing and faster feedback.
  • Participated in Agile/Scrum ceremonies and Collaborated with the product owner to prioritise and plan testing activities.
  • Senior Quality Assurance Engineer, L&T Technology Services
    08/2017 – 02/2019 | Bangalore, India
  • Coordinated and performed functional, integration, compatibility and regression testing, developed test plans and test cases, and managed bug reports of Pay TV technology, integration, EPG/MW stack with STB/Chipset vendors, and testing and automation.
  • Certificates
    Selenium Training

    Selenium with java

    Cisco certified ninja green belt.
    Cisco certified advanced white belt
    Education
    Vidya Vikash Institute of Engineering and Technology, B.E, Computer Science & Engineering
    07/2003 – 07/2007 | Mysore, India
    College OF Commerce, 12th | Senior School Certificate Examination
    07/1999 – 07/2001 | Patna, India
    DAV Public School, Bokaro, 10th | Secondary School Examination
    06/1999 | Bokaro Steel City, India
    Languages
    English
    Hindi
  • Implemented EPG(Java) STB features such as USB playback, BSCL to improve customer experience
  • Created an automation in Python to extract Guide Analytics data, and verify the recommendation engine behaviour in STB. Achieved a 50% improvement in recommended engine accuracy for on-demand content with a 95% confidence interval
  • Mentored junior QA engineers on testing processes, documentation, defect tracking, and test reporting.
  • Senior Quality Assurance Engineer, Cisco Video Technologies India Pvt Ltd
    05/2013 – 07/2017 | Bangalore, India
  • Investigated and integrated jailbreak security for webkit browser.
  • Guided and secured an Embedded Linux system by performing Linux Hardening compliance, a Security Review Process in which Hundreds of security metrics had to be met.
  • Performed first code level bug investigation on more than 50 bugs, thereby reducing the bug turn-around time from 12 hours to 6 hours.
  • Successfully completed test execution and defect tracking of the firm's proprietary software systems, ensuring that the projects were completed on time and within budget.
  • Senior Quality Assurance Engineer, NDS Services Pay TV Technology Pvt Ltd
    12/2010 – 04/2013 | Bangalore, India
  • Conducted regression, stability, and stress testing on 19 chipset configurations of STB platforms using existing tools and test suites to provide detailed test reports and metrics of performance data.
  • Developed and executed stress test plans that included load and performance components, to identify and verify performance and reliability issues.
  • Successfully executed ATP on 19 chipsets at customer place, achieving 0% defect rate
  • Senior Engineer, TATA ELXSI Limited
    08/2007 – 11/2010 | Bangalore, India
  • Performed manual testing activities for broadcast management systems, content management systems, and media workflows.
  • Designed and executed test cases to validate software functionality, performance, and usability.
  • Identified, documented, and tracked software defects using defect tracking tools such as bugzila
  • Collaborated with cross-functional teams to troubleshoot and resolve issues in a timely manner.
  • Actively participated in the improvement of testing processes and methodologies in the broadcasting domain.